The gift was a watch valued at approximately $1,300.00. As he attempted to purchase that watch, Mr. Brown was allegedly approached by the store's security. He was then falsely accused of credit card fraud. As a result, he was handcuffed. Fortunately, Mr. Brown was released, but only after allegedly being ridiculed by the officers who did not believe he could afford the watch.
